We are IdeaSoft’s Ethereum-focused R&D Department – a small, fast, and relentless team building new Web3 applications from zero to one. We ship fast, break things, validate ideas, and pivot quickly.
Now, we are looking for a Backend Developer (Node.js) who thrives in chaos, doesn’t need Jira to get things done, and loves building new products in the Ethereum ecosystem.
Bonus Points
You have shipped a Web3 product before (even a hackathon POC counts)
Familiar with Uniswap V4, Farcaster, AI agents, session keys, or anything cutting-edge in Ethereum
You’ve contributed to open source or written technical articles
Requirements:
Solid experience with Node.js, TypeScript, and building REST/GraphQL APIs (usually NestJS)
Comfortable with Ethereum/Web3 libraries (ethers.js, viem, etc.)
Experience with smart contract integrations, event listening, or building indexers is a big plus
You’re fast. We don’t mean reckless. We mean you prefer to ship something in 2 days rather than perfect it for 2 weeks
You can work without Jira, PMs, or daily standups. You take responsibility and move
You’re resourceful, scrappy, and can Google your way through tough problems
Responsibilities:
Build backend logic for new Ethereum-based applications (Mini apps, DeFi, AI agents, etc.)
Integrate on-chain and off-chain components: smart contracts, indexers, APIs, bots
Write fast and functional prototypes, iterate based on feedback, and push to production when needed
Deploy and manage infrastructure (we use Docker, PostgreSQL, Redis, etc.)
Own what you build. If something breaks, you fix it